Teen slasher movies that includes a bunch of protagonists pursued by a relentless killer after masking up an unintended demise or crime are a preferred subgenre of horror. These movies usually incorporate components of thriller, suspense, and whodunit tropes, inserting a powerful emphasis on the psychological torment skilled by the characters as their previous actions return to hang-out them. The 1997 movie that includes Jennifer Love Hewitt and Sarah Michelle Gellar serves as a first-rate instance, popularizing most of the style’s conventions.
This subgenre faucets into primal fears of accountability and the implications of previous misdeeds. The enduring attraction of those narratives lies within the exploration of guilt, paranoia, and the fragility of youthful invincibility. Traditionally, these movies replicate societal anxieties and ethical panics, significantly surrounding teenage conduct and rise up. In addition they present a cathartic expertise for audiences by way of the stylized depiction of violence and survival.
